An absorbent article comprising an absorbent body, a surface sheet arranged on the side facing the skin from the absorbent body, and an intermediate sheet arranged between the absorbent body and the surface sheet,
In the surface sheet,
A plurality of first embossed rows in which a plurality of linear embossed portions are intermittently arranged in series so that the longitudinal direction of each linear embossed portion faces the same direction, and a plurality of linear embossed portions are connected to each linear embossed portion A plurality of second embossed rows intermittently arranged in series so that the longitudinal direction of the
The first embossed row and the second embossed row intersect each other,
A convex region defined by the first embossed row and the second embossed row and containing the constituent fibers in the entire thickness direction is formed,
A first high-density region having a higher density than the convex region is located at the intersection of the first embossed row and the second embossed row,
The plurality of linear embossed portions are formed only on the surface sheet,
A plurality of fused portions are formed in the intermediate sheet,
In plan view, the first high-density region and the fused portion at least partially overlap ,
A second high-density region having a higher density than a portion other than the fused portion is formed in the intermediate sheet,
the fused portion is defined by the second high-density region;
In plan view, the first high-density region and the second high-density region at least partially overlap,
The surface sheet has a flat non-skin facing surface,
In plan view, the surface sheet and the intermediate sheet are joined with an adhesive at a position where the first high-density region and the second high-density region at least partially overlap,
The first high-density region includes the ends of two linear embossed portions adjacent to each other across the intersection point in the first embossed row, and the two linear embossed portions adjacent to each other across the intersection point in the second embossed row. is a perfect circular area that touches the edge of
The absorbent article , wherein the overlapping area ratio of the first high-density region and the fused portion is 15% or more and 45% or less .
